Wheel removal — branch by vehicle type
E-BIKE — FRONT HUB MOTOR (remove)ebikeebike-front-hubvehicle:ebike/tire-tube/front-hub-removebrake-type:hydraulic-disc-removebrake-type:mechanical-disc-remove
A.r1Locate motor cable connector at fork dropout
captureFound the motor plug at the dropout?
A.r2Squeeze locking collar, pull straight (no twist)
capturePlug pulled apart clean — any bent pins?
PASS / FAIL
A.r3Cut zip ties along fork leg
captureZip ties cut off the fork leg?
A.r4Loosen axle nuts (15/18 mm) or thru-axle
captureAxle nuts or thru-axle loose?
captureWrench size you used — how many mm?
VALUE · mm
A.r5Verify torque-washer tab seats in dropout slot
captureTorque-washer tab seated in the dropout slot?
captureSnap a photo of the seated washer.
PASS / FAILPHOTO
A.r6Lift fork off wheel; lay wheel CABLE-SIDE UP
captureWheel out and lying cable-side up?
E-BIKE — REAR HUB MOTOR (remove)ebikeebike-rear-hubvehicle:ebike/tire-tube/rear-hub-removebrake-type:hydraulic-disc-removebrake-type:mechanical-disc-remove
B.r1Shift to smallest cog, then power off
captureShifted to the smallest cog and powered off?
B.r2Locate motor cable plug near dropout
captureFound the motor plug near the dropout?
B.r3Cut zip tie, unplug (align arrows — pins bend easily)
capturePlug off — any bent pins?
PASS / FAIL
B.r4Loosen axle nuts (18 mm typ., reinstall 30–40 Nm)
captureAxle nuts off?
captureReinstall torque you'll set — how many N·m?
VALUE · Nm
B.r5Push derailleur back, lift FRAME off wheel (don't flip bike)
captureFrame lifted clear of the wheel?
B.r6Lay wheel CABLE-SIDE UP
captureWheel resting cable-side up?
PASS / FAIL
criticalNever lay wheel on motor-cable side

EUC (electric unicycle) (remove)eucvehicle:euc/tire-tube/euc-removebrake-type:none-remove
I.r1Power off, lay on padded surface
capturePowered off and laid on a padded surface?
I.r2Remove pedals (17 mm typically)
captureBoth pedals off?
I.r3Remove outer shell panels (Phillips/hex, brand-dependent)
captureOuter shell panels off?
I.r4Remove inner shell to expose wheel + motor
captureInner shell off, wheel and motor exposed?
captureSnap a photo of the screws sorted by location.
PHOTO
I.r5Disconnect motor phase + Hall plug at controller
capturePhase and Hall plug disconnected at the controller?
I.r6Loosen axle nuts; slide wheel out
captureAxle nuts off, wheel slid out?
captureReinstall torque for the axle nuts — how many N·m?
VALUE · Nm
warningTrack all screws by location — shells use multiple lengths
ONEWHEEL (Pint/XR/GT/GTS) (remove)onewheelvehicle:onewheel/tire-tube/onewheel-removebrake-type:none-remove
J.r1Power off, remove front and rear bumpers
capturePowered off, front and rear bumpers off?
J.r2Remove footpad screws (Pint/XR: 1/8" hex; GT/GTS: T25)
captureFootpad screws out?
captureSnap a photo of the footpad screws sorted by location.
PHOTO
J.r3Lift footpad, disconnect sensor cable (smaller half only!)
captureFootpad lifted, sensor cable disconnected at the smaller half?
J.r4Remove fender bolts
captureFender bolts out?
J.r5Remove battery-side and controller-side end-cap bolts
captureBattery-side and controller-side end-cap bolts out?
J.r6Slide axle out; motor stays in tire
captureAxle slid out, motor still in the tire?
captureGT/GTS only — controller re-paired after reassembly?
PASS / FAIL
criticalGT/GTS: controllers are board-locked — re-pair required after

atom:hub-cable-reinstall4 steps
12hub-cable-reinstall/1
Always disconnect at the plug — never the wheel-side
captureDisconnected at the plug, not the wheel-side?
13hub-cable-reinstall/2
Orient axle cable-notch correctly (forward per most makers)
captureAxle cable-notch oriented forward?
14hub-cable-reinstall/3
Align connector arrows on reconnect
captureConnector arrows aligned on reconnect?
15hub-cable-reinstall/4
Zip-tie cable away from rotor, chain, suspension pinch points
captureCable zip-tied clear of rotor, chain, and pinch points?
captureEnough slack for full lock-to-lock steering with no pinch?
captureSnap a photo of the final cable routing and strain relief.
PASS / FAILPHOTO
criticalStutter/low power after reinstall = 90% bad connector seating
